예제 #1
0
 //* -----------------------------------------------------------------------*
 /// <summary>ロード処理</summary>
 protected override void LoadContent()
 {
     CLogger.add("ゲームリソースを読込しています...");
     SStarter <_T> .SXACTInitializeData xact = initializeData.XACTConfigure;
     if (xact)
     {
         audio = new CAudio(xact.index2assert, xact.loopSEInterval,
                            xact.fileXGS, xact.fileXSB, xact.fileXWBSE, xact.fileXWBBGM);
     }
     textureResourceManager.reload(true, Content);
     fontResourceManager.reload(true, Content);
     if (spriteDraw != null)
     {
         spriteDraw.Dispose();
     }
     spriteDraw = new CSprite(GraphicsDevice);
     GC.Collect();
     base.LoadContent();
     CLogger.add("ゲームリソースの読込完了。");
 }
예제 #2
0
 //* -----------------------------------------------------------------------*
 /// <summary>ロード処理</summary>
 protected override void LoadContent()
 {
     CLogger.add("ゲームリソースを読込しています...");
     SStarter <_T> .SXACTInitializeData xact = INITIALIZE_DATA.XACTConfigure;
     if (xact)
     {
         audio = new CAudio(xact.index2assert, xact.loopSEInterval,
                            xact.fileXGS, xact.fileXSB, xact.fileXWBSE, xact.fileXWBBGM);
     }
     RESOURCE_MANAGER_TEXTURE.reload(true, Content);
     RESOURCE_MANAGER_FONT.reload(true, Content);
     if (spriteDraw != null)
     {
         spriteDraw.Dispose();
     }
     spriteDraw = new CSprite(GraphicsDevice);
     GC.Collect();
     base.LoadContent();
     CLogger.add("ゲームリソースの読込完了。");
 }